Kie asked me to take part in this video an age ago and I shot my part very early this year (Jan? 2011) and through the miracle of the internet I sent him my ready to go part and he grafted into his fantastic production.

I shot it on a Canon 60d with a 17-55mm F/2.8 lens and coloured it with Colorista in After Effects CS4 I hadn't gone 64 bit at that point (altho am only halfway there now as I don't have any 64 bit apps to use up my 16 gigs) .

I don't know what Kie shot his on but it is very clear and bright always a good thing, you can always muddy things up later if need be, I really like his keying on the News Report section and I think the weather girl is quite fetching too in a albeit unconventional way.

Collaboration's with other "Youtubers" is a great way to combine efforts and reach a wider audience and is something I would thoroughly recommend as it's always great to talk shop with fellow film makers and maybe pick up new tips in this constantly evolving arena that is digital film making
